Types of Replacement Car Keys
When it pertains to replacing car keys, it's vital to determine the kind of key that your vehicle utilizes, as this figures out how you can obtain a replacement. Below are the most typical types of car keys:
1. Standard Metal Keys
Standard car keys are made from metal and do not contain any electronic parts. They normally have grooves that need to match the car's ignition cylinder to start the engine.
2. Transponder Keys
Transponder keys have an ingrained chip that sends a signal to the car's ignition system. If the signal matches, the engine will begin. Although these keys are more safe and secure than conventional keys, they can be expensive to replace.
3. Smart Keys/ Key Fobs
Smart keys, or key fobs, are sophisticated systems that enable keyless entry and ignition. They use radio frequency identification (RFID) technology to begin the car without physically inserting a key into the ignition. These keys can be more costly to replace due to their intricacy.
4. Switchblade Keys
These are keys that fold into a fob for simple carrying. They frequently contain transponder chips similar to standard car keys, making them a blend of traditional and contemporary innovation.
5. Valet Keys
Valet keys are created for parking attendants. These keys allow limited access to the vehicle, typically avoiding access to the trunk or glove compartment. They are generally an easier variation of routine keys.
How to Obtain Replacement Car Keys
When the type of key is identified, it's time to think about the numerous approaches of obtaining a replacement:
Method | Description | Cost Range |
---|---|---|
Car dealership | Licensed car dealerships can configure and cut replacement keys. | ₤ 100 - ₤ 500 (or more) |
Locksmith | Professional locksmith professionals can create replacement keys for many lorries at a lower expense. | ₤ 50 - ₤ 250 |
Third-party Services | Online services that provide key replacement by means of shipping. | ₤ 30 - ₤ 200 |
DIY Kits | Some retailers offer DIY key replacement sets, however they may have limitations and dangers. | ₤ 20 - ₤ 100 |
In-depth Steps to Replace Car Keys
Identify the Key Type: Knowing the kind of key will guide you in picking the right replacement technique.
Gather Necessary Information: Important information such as Vehicle Identification Number (VIN) and existing key design (if available) are crucial.
Choose a Replacement Method: Whether to check out the car dealership, a locksmith, or use an online service or DIY package.
Program the Key: Keys such as transponders and smart keys must be programmed to the vehicle, generally needing specialized equipment.
Check the New Key: Always evaluate the replacement key to ensure it works properly in beginning the vehicle and accessing all functions.
Often Asked Questions (FAQs)
1. Can I replace my car key myself?
While some key replacements can be done using DIY kits, it is usually suggested to go through a professional to ensure that the key is correctly cut and configured.
2. For how long does it take to replace a car key?
The time it takes can differ greatly depending upon the approach of replacement. A locksmith professional can often develop a brand-new key in about 1 hour, while a dealer may take longer due to programming.
3. Is it possible to replace a lost wise key?
Yes, even if you've lost a wise key, you can obtain a replacement through a dealership or a certified locksmith who recognizes with shows smart keys.
4. What are the expenses associated with changing a car key?
Costs can vary widely depending on the type of key and replacement method. Traditional keys are normally cheaper, while wise keys can be considerably more expensive due to their innovation.
5. Do I require my car to get a replacement key?
In most cases, particularly for transponder and clever keys, you will require the vehicle present for programs. Nevertheless, if you're dealing with a locksmith professional who can make a key from the VIN, it may be possible to replace it without having the car.
